Sažetak
The anti-ballistic protective fabrics are currently made of multiple layers of lamina in order to stop bullets with spreading it’ s kinetics energy. In order to solve stability and collapse phenomena, single-walled carbon nanotubes (CNT) are treated as equivalent thin-walled continuum cylindrical structures with comparison molecular dynamics solution. The effective mechanical properties on multiple material scale of the protective lamina is determined by stochastic model of planar fibre network. CNT/polymer nanocomposite as another form personal protection also commented.
